Volkswagen Golf GTI Pre-Bookings Begin in India: Hot Hatch Arriving Soon with 260hp Turbo Power

The legendary Golf GTI is positioned to ignite the performance hatch sector in the country. Pre-bookings are open at 2.65 lakh. Although the launch date is still kept under wraps, sources indicate the full-loaded GTI could arrive at showroom floors within a matter of weeks, for the enthusiasts who have waited so long for the GTI's maiden entry on Indian soil.

Power-Packed Performance from a 2.0L Turbo Engine

Powering the 2025 Volkswagen Golf GTI is a 2.0-litre four-cylinder TSI petrol mill, churning 260bhp and 370Nm of torque. Mated to a 7-speed DSG automatic transmission, the GTI is probably supposed to pool out acceleration with response-worthy actions.

Globally known for the nail-biting grip and razor-sharp steering, this hot hatch should find itself at home on twisties and the city grind.

Premium Features & Bold Styling

Golf GTI isn’t just a stereotype performance car that turns heads; it houses some premium features, too. You have to expect the likes of a 12.9-inch touchscreen infotainment system, a 10.25-inch digital driver's display, wireless phone charging, and ambient lighting. Fairly important would be the seven airbags and the panoramic sunroof.

On the outside, 18-inch alloy wheels, red GTI badging, wrap-around LED tail-lamps, and an illuminated VW logo coupled with dual chrome exhausts to form a very purposeful yet sporty stance.

Dimensions and Practicality

Despite being performance-oriented, the GTI has an everyday usability side to it. Measuring 4,289mm in length, 1,789mm in width, and 1,471mm in height, with a wheelbase of 2,627mm, the Golf GTI makes for a well-balanced practical proposition. It has a ground clearance of 136mm and a fuel tank that stores up to 45 litres, which is good for taking it around on the somewhat unforgiving Indian tarmac.
